## PR: Harden donation-receipt mailer retry path

This change updates the GiveSprig receipt mailer to sign receipt payloads before enqueueing and to reject templates containing unescaped donor fields. Rendering now runs in a sandboxed worker with no network egress, and bounce handling no longer logs full recipient records. I'd especially like review of the rate-limit and backoff logic, since it gates how fast we drain the queue after an outage. The effective tuning constants are listed below for audit.

tuning table, yajog-yahof:
BUDGETS = {
    "lamvan": 303,
    "wenox": 460,
    "fenvan": 525,
}

**Vendor note: Inkmill markdown pipeline**

Rendering for Parchway docs is outsourced to Inkmill under an annual contract, renewing each March. They handle sanitization and PDF export; we own the upload queue. SLA: 4-hour response on rendering failures. Escalate only after two failed retries. Their support desk is reachable at the address below.

billing contact of hahaf-baguf = zorael.tammir.jorius@sivrelhq.internal

- [ ] **Studio intro.** Take the new starter down to the Lumen Room, where we record training videos. Show them the booking sheet, the "recording in progress" light, and where the lapel mics live. Remind them to silence phones before entering. The door code for the studio is just below.

staff pass of kawip-hawef = bdg-QLP-2